Breast cancer patients who have completed their treatment journey often experience mixed emotions as they enter the remission phase. It has been a challenging road, but reaching the end of breast cancer treatment, with clear margins and lifted burdens, brings feelings of relief, gratitude, and perhaps some apprehension about the future.
The good news is that breast cancer survivors can lead full and active lives, and there are several important aspects to consider as you move forward through remission. In this article, we will discuss valuable advice and strategies to help you navigate life after breast cancer.
Recovery after breast cancer treatment varies depending on the treatment received. It is important to acknowledge that your energy levels may take time to return to normal. Be kind to yourself during this period, and do not push too hard. Listen to your body and allow yourself the rest you need to recover fully.
For those who have undergone breast cancer surgery, recovery usually takes a couple of weeks. During this time, you should prioritize rest and let your body heal. Although complications from surgery are rare, they can include infection, bleeding, and pain. Consider the following recommendations to minimize these risks and expedite recovery:
Physical exercise is vital in the lives of breast cancer survivors like you, benefitting your physical and mental health. Regular physical exercise can alleviate treatment-related side effects like fatigue and anxiety and improve overall quality of life. Begin with gentle exercises and gradually increase your activity levels as you feel ready and comfortable.

Numerous support groups and online communities are available for breast cancer survivors, offering a platform for connecting with others who understand the challenges and triumphs of recovery. Reach out, share your experiences, and draw strength from the collective wisdom and support of fellow survivors.
There are abundant resources available to breast cancer survivors, so never hesitate to seek help when needed.
This is important because your journey has undoubtedly been physically and emotionally exhausting. Prioritize regular checkups with your doctor to monitor your health, ensure you are getting enough sleep, maintain a balanced diet, incorporate regular exercise into your routine, and find ways to relax and de-stress.
Your treatment may have put certain plans on hold, such as family visits or postponed trips. Once you have been cleared to resume normal activities, take control of your life and live it to the fullest.
